Output 2387626b1e68f2bbffe593c66a9a396e39a9e720e62bddef8ca1ab45b6b51d30:1

value
152651
script pubkey
OP_0 OP_PUSHBYTES_20 d6931d4d6a6c3c76a5b02acf2e2905b89776786c
address
bc1q66f36nt2ds78dfds9t8ju2g9hzthv7rv98qg5r
transaction
2387626b1e68f2bbffe593c66a9a396e39a9e720e62bddef8ca1ab45b6b51d30
confirmations
53843
spent
true